ROCKY CREEK BRIDGE AT FM 50 CLOSED FOR REPAIRS

  

TxDOT is currently working on replacing the Rocky Creek Bridge at FM 50.

The project consists of the bridge replacement, along with road improvements along FM 50 starting at Highway 105 and going five miles north.  The bridge was damaged during May 2016’s storms.

According to TxDOT Resident Engineer Mark Shafer, work will include reworking the pavement and widening the shoulder.  The project officially began July 15th.

 

 

Shafer said drivers will be detoured throughout this 90-day period.  They should still expect delays after that, as the road will still be under construction.

 

 

Shafer said the project is contracted out to Big Creek Construction for $6.5 million.
